To Dr. Yunus


First, let me take this opportunity to congratulate you, belatedly though, for receiving the Nobel Peace Prize 2006. That was a great moment for all of us as you are the third Bengalee and the first Bangladeshi to receive the Nobel Prize. You have made us proud.

Now, come to the main point. The news of your joining politics is on the air for quite some time. Every citizen would welcome honest and educated people to politics. There is no doubt about that. But politics is not JUST ONLY about honest people... it's mainly about ideology. Had it not been so, we would have preferred some religious party to the AL or the BNP, for they may be less corrupt financially than the two major parties. But we don't. And many people think the same about the communists.

We are not sure about your political ideology-- honesty, corruption-free society , improvement of Chittagong port etc cannot be the ideology of any political party, rather these are the goals that could be set by a party.

So, please declare your political ideology & party constitution before you seek public opinion.
